The AI Conversion Agent (AICA) can be set up for the two use-cases it supports: Workshop Confirmation and Single-Question Text Reactivation.


AICA for Workshop Confirmation 

  • In Location Settings, (Settings cog icon > Location Settings > Edit) the following fields are available:

    • AI Agent > Agent Name (will default to "Emily" if this field is left alone) 

    • AI Agent > Agent Background (will default to "Emily’s" background)



    • AI Agent > Insurance Info (no default): 

      • Be as specific as possible. Keep in mind, you are programming how AICA will respond, and it will make up answers using resources available on the internet if specific information is not available in this field.

        • Ex: Patient should verify with their insurer whether a referral is required. 

        • Ex: We do not accept Blue Cross of Idaho, but do not offer that information to the contact unless specifically asked about that company. 




      • AI Agent > AI Working Hours:
      • AI Working Hours fields in Location Settings governs when AICA is active. 

        • These fields default to 8am to 8pm 7 days a week but are configurable by the user. 

        • When reactivated, AICA will follow up with any contact who messaged while it was inactive.  




      • Address > Location Office Hours:
      • Location Office Hours fields are available to AICA and it will respond to questions about appointment availability based on that information. 

        • For Example: “Do you have Saturday appointments available?” “No, I’m sorry, we are closed on Saturdays. We’re open on XYZ days at ABC times, is there a time on those days that works for you?” 

        • These fields default to 8am to 5pm M-F but are configurable by the user. 


      • AI Agent > Virtual Assistant Disclosure:
      • The "Disclose if virtual assistant" button programs AICA to identify itself as a "virtual assistant" if asked directly. 

        • This button is OFF by default 

        • Only works if asked a direct question, such as "Are you a bot?" or "Are you a real human?" - AICA will not proactively offer the information. 

          • NOTE: There is a known bug where custom information in the Background field can override this directive.




    • The workshop must be AI Enabled 

      - In the Funnel dropdown on the New Event modal, funnels that are AI-enabled have a sparkle icon 

      • There is an AI Agent toggle on the New Event modal 
      • Workshops scheduled using an AI-enabled funnel will automatically have toggle in the ON position 

      • Toggle will not appear for workshops scheduled using a funnel that is not AI-enabled 

    • In Funnel Create/Edit in Location Settings, the following field is available: 
    • Workshop Description (no default in software, but template copy is available in this Help Center article

      Keep in mind, you want to be specific as possible. AICA will make up answers if information is not provided. 

      • Ex: The workshop is being hosted by Dr. Phil Teddy, who has been a PT for 18 years. He attended University of Florida and has a fellowship in Rotator Cuff treatment modalities. 

      • Ex: We have a small parking lot but overflow parking is available at the shopping plaza across the street. 


AICA for Single-Question Text Reactivation

  • In Location Settings, (Settings cog icon > Location Settings > Edit) the following fields are available:

    • The campaign can be AI Enabled at both the template (admin) level and the user level. 
    • Admin 

      • AI Agent toggle is on the Save Campaign modal. 

        • Toggle is only functional if an SMS step is present in the campaign. 

        • If SMS step is present, toggle is still in OFF position by default.

      • User
      • Schedule Campaign > Pre-Built > Edit

        • AI Agent toggle is on the Save Campaign modal 

          • Toggle is only functional if an SMS step is present in the campaign.

          • If SMS step is present, toggle is still in OFF position by default.

        • Schedule Campaign >  SMS 
        • AI Agent toggle is located below the copy box 

        • Toggle is always in OFF position by default 


        NOTE: AICA can technically be enabled for any SMS campaign, however, the prompt is written and tested specifically with Single Question appointment booking goals in mind. Functionality is not guaranteed with any other campaign type.
